"do some customer service training and make sure some of the staff can speak English"

If you have a question the clerk can't answer or you can't break through the language barrier, get the phone number of the shop and go to one of the information kiosks on the first floor. Have one of the English speaking girls there call the shop and work it out. In some cases, they'll accompany you to the shop and serve as an interpreter.
